묻고 답해요
141만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
해결됨Slack 클론 코딩[실시간 채팅 with React]
강의소개에서
강의소개보면 swr(리덕스대체) 라고 나와있는데 swr도 리덕스처럼 상태관리를 하는건가요?
-
미해결리액트로 구현하는 블록체인 이더리움 ERC721(NFT)
프로젝트 구성에 대해서 질문을 드려봅니다.
안녕하세요. 회사에서 NFT를 발행해주는 프로젝트를 진행하려는데요. 올려주신 강의를 보고 하나씩 처리를 해가고 있는데, 프로젝트 구성의 감을 잡지 못해서 문의를 좀 드리려고 합니다. 이 곳에 질문을 남겨도 될지는 모르겠지만, 너무 답답해서 문의를 드립니다. nodejs 를 사용해 backend(API 서버)를 만들고 raect(3000번 포트) 에서 proxy 를 설정해 nodejs(3001번 포트) 의 데이터를 받아오도록 frontend를 만드는 프로젝트를 진행하고 있습니다. 이 프로젝트는 NFT를 발행해주는 사이트를 만드는 것이 목표인데요. 만약 올려주신 drizzle-dapp으로 backend(API 서버)와 연결하는 back을 만들려면 package.json의 main을 truffle-config.js로 해도 괜찮을까요? 그게 아니라면 프록시서버를 따로 두지 않고 react-node 가 proxy로 설정되어 있는 상태로 NFT 거래가 가능하게 만들려면 truffle 을 어떻게 사용해야 할지 조언 해주실 수 있을까요...? 강의 내용과 맞지 않는 내용 올려서 죄송합니다.
-
미해결리액트로 나만의 블로그 만들기(MERN Stack)
몽고db 사이트가 많이 바뀌어서
몽고db 사이트가 많이바뀌어서 cluster 화면이 너무많이바뀌어서 강의를 알아들을수없습니다.
-
미해결Slack 클론 코딩[실시간 채팅 with React]
onCreateWorkspace Submit 무반응
안녕하세요! 지금까지는 문제 없이 잘 진행하고 있었으나 계속 찾아보고, alecture 폴더 내에 있는 소스코드와 비교를 해보아도 어떤 코드가 문제인지 모르겠어서 질문 글을 남기게 되었습니다. 해당 섹션 마지막에서 액시오스 코드를 작성하고 백엔드에 워크 스페이스를 생성하도록 요청하는 부분이 있는데요, const onCreateWorkspace = useCallback((e) => { console.log('ok'); e.preventDefault(); console.log(newWorkspace); if (!newWorkspace || !newWorkspace.trim()) return; console.log('b'); if (!newUrl || !newUrl.trim()) return; console.log('c'); axios.post('/api/workspaces', { workspace: newWorkspace, url: newUrl, }, { withCredentials: true, }, ).then((response) => { revalidate(); setShowCreateWorkspaceModal(false); setNewWorkspace(''); setNewUrl(''); }).catch((error) => { console.dir(error); toast.error(error.response?.data, { position: 'bottom-center' }); }); }, []); 워크스페이스 이름과, 워크스페이스 url 을 넣고 생성하기 버튼을 누르면 반응이 없어서 위 코드처럼 console.log 를 찍어서 확인해보니 newWorkspace 에 아무런 값이 담기지가 않고 있습니다. 해당 소스코드 및 라인 : https://github.com/Kuass/sleact/blob/master/setting/ts/layouts/Workspace/index.tsx#L32 입니다. onCreateWorkspace = useCallback 에 event 객체도 콘솔에 찍어서 보았으나 값은 정상적으로 있는데.. 왜 이럴까요 강사님 ㅠㅠ..
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 기본 강의
콜백함수가 헷갈려서 질문 드립니다!
index.js에서 user.comparePassword를 호출할 때 req.body.passwod로 비밀번호를 인자로 전달하고 뒤에 err, isMatch는 comparePassword 메소드에서 cb(err)과 cb(null, isMatch)로 받아와서 비밀번호가 틀렸습니다 쪽으로 넘어가는 것 같은데 제가 이해한 게 맞을까요...??
-
해결됨파이썬/장고 웹서비스 개발 완벽 가이드 with 리액트
Django 로 이용한 머신러닝/딥러닝 서비스
안녕하세요 강사님 퀄리티 높은 강의와 디테일좋은 강의 감사드립니다. 머신러닝에도 관심이 있어 공부를 하던와중에 내가직접 서비스를 하려면 백엔드의 지식도 필요할듯하여 감사하게 강의를 듣고있습니다. 머신러닝/딥러닝 서비스를 사용하기위한 백엔드 서비스가 Django 가 좋은것같은데 현업에서도 많은 사용을 하고있나요? (아마 강사님께서도 많은 컨설팅을 해주셔서 아실거라 생각이 들어 질문을 드립니다.) 딥러닝 모델을 웹에서 돌리기위해서는 병렬처리?가 필요할듯한데 Django 에서는 이러한 부분에대한 솔루션이 있는지 또한 궁금합니다. 감사합니다.
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
put
그래프큐엘을 다시 보면서 강의 정주행 해보고 있습니다.질문: update message 부분을 put 대신에 patch로 리팩토링해도 괜찮을까요? 저는 프론트 위주로만 알고 있어서 api쪽은 단순히 전체 update는 put, 부분적인 data 수정은 patch 정도로만 알고 있는데요, 어떤 경우 put/patch를 쓰는 게 더 좋은지 의견 궁금해서 남깁니다.
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
next파일 생성이 안됨
그대로 디펜더시 다운후에 next,react 파일이 안생기는데 그냥 npx 로 다운받아야하나요? (경로확인했습니다)
-
해결됨프론트엔드 개발자를 위한, 실전 웹 성능 최적화(feat. React) - Part. 2
Items 페이지 내 이미지 깨지는 오류
동균님 안녕하세요. 좋은 강의 공유해주셔서 감사합니다 :) 지금 페이지를 로컬에서 띄워보면서 페이지 분석을 하고 있는데요, Items 페이지의 보드들의 이미지가 깨져서 보입니다. 또한 보드 클릭시 이동하는 링크도 현재 존재하지 않아 리다이렉트되는 것 같습니다. Network탭을 확인해보니 이미지 파일에 대한 Response 가 500 으로 오고 있습니다. land-mfg.com 의 대대적인 홈페이지 개편이 있었던 걸까요..? 참고목적으로 스크린샷 공유드립니다 :)
-
해결됨프론트엔드 개발자를 위한, 실전 웹 성능 최적화(feat. React) - Part. 2
3-2) 서비스 탐색 및 코드 분석 내 소스코드 링크 오류
안녕하세요! 좋은 강의 공유해주셔서 감사합니다. Part1 에 이어 Part2도 즐겁게 수강하고 있습니다 :) 다름이 아니라 3-2) 서비스탐색 및 코드 분석 강의 하단에 있는 소스코드의 링크가 문구와는 다르게 lecture-4 를 가리키고 있습니다. lecture-3로 변경이 필요할 것 같습니다. clone하고 나서 순간 좀 당황했네요 ㅎㅎ..
-
미해결오픈 소스 자바스크립트 React 프로그래밍 입문 Part.1
22년 최신버전 visual studio 사용 솔루션 탐색기 셋팅
222년 기준 최신 버전 vs를 깔고 강의대로 진행해보았을 때 솔루션 탐색기에 목록이 다른 점이 많아서요.. 구버전으로 새로 까는 것이 나을까요? 아니면 여기서 해결방안이 있을까요?
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
yarn run client
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요! - 먼저 유사한 질문이 있었는지 검색해보세요. - 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. 환경 세팅하고 yarn run client으로 "simple sns" 정상출력 확인 후 목록뷰 구현하기에서 코드 친 후 yarn run client하니 갑자기 빈페이지에 아래 오류가 뜨는데 구글링해도 방법을 잘 모르겠습니다ㅜ
-
해결됨프론트엔드 개발자를 위한, 실전 웹 성능 최적화(feat. React) - Part. 2
lazy load 의 layout shift에 대하여
이강의에서는 이전강의에서 layout shift 에 대한 처리를 해서 현재는 발생하지 않고있지만, 보통이라면 lazy loading 을 할때 layout shift 가 반드시 따라올것같은데 image lazy loading시에는 선작업으로 무조건 layout shift를 없애주어야하는것일까요?
-
해결됨프론트엔드 개발자를 위한, 실전 웹 성능 최적화(feat. React) - Part. 2
질문이있습니다.
- 학습 관련 질문을 남겨주세요. 상세히 작성하면 더 좋아요! - 먼저 유사한 질문이 있었는지 검색해보세요. - 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. 먼저 좋은 강의감사합니다. 질문이있습니다. 보여주신 예제는 전부 동일한 이미지일때인데 각 이미지마다 사이즈가 다른 갤러리에서는 어떻게 적용하면 좋을까요 ? 예를들어 이런 사이트의 형식입니다. https://www.pinterest.com/seanbiehle/finterest/
-
미해결따라하며 배우는 리액트, 파이어베이스 - 채팅 어플리케이션 만들기[2023.12 리뉴얼]
파이어베이스 관련 npm run build 에러
파이어베이스 관련 npm run build 에러 가 나와서 문의드립니다. 무엇이 에러인지를 모르겠습니다. 검토바랍니다. ./src/firebase.jsSyntaxError: /Users/ucoder/Documents/GitHub/react-firebase-chat/src/firebase.js: Unexpected token (1:22)> 1 | import {intializeApp} firebase from "firebase/app"; | ^ 2 | import "firebase/auth"; 3 | import "firebase/database"; 4 | import "firebase/storage"; import firebase from "firebase/app"; 으로 변경했으나 아래와 같은 메시지가 나옵니다. Failed to compile. ./src/firebase.js Attempted import error: 'firebase/app' does not contain a default export (imported as 'firebase').
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
수강전문의 next js 버전업데이트
강의는 next 11버전인데 지금은 12버전더라구요 혹시 수강하는데 문제없을까요? 그 11대응영상만 참고하면 에러사항없을까요?
-
미해결생활코딩 - React
chrome에서 화면 전환이 안됩니다...
10강 리엑트가 없다면 진행하던 도중 pure.html를 추가하여 해당 html을 확인하는 도중 마이크로소프트 엣지에서는 html이 확인되는데, 크롬에서는 확인이 되지 않습니다... 구글링했는데도 원인을 찾지 못해 질문 남깁니다 ㅠㅠ 를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요.
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
강의내용 질문
강의 7:01 부분의 16번쨰 코드내용에대한 질문입니다! 노드js는 처음이라서 우선 강의따라 흐름만 이해하면서 듣고있습니다! 16번쨰줄의 내용이 서버가 실행될때 forEach로 순회하면서 messagesRoute에서 정의한 메서드들을 실행하는 내용같은데, 작성된 문법이라면 현재 url외의 메서드들도 순회하면서 전부 실행 시키는 중인가요??
-
해결됨풀스택 리액트 토이프로젝트 - REST, GraphQL (for FE개발자)
setEditingId 질문 있습니다!
안녕하세요? page를 처음 렌더링하고 MsgItem의 수정을 클릭하여 startEdit을 실행하면 setEditingId(x.id)를 실행시키는데요. 바로 console.log(x.id)와 console.log(editingId)를 찍어보면 x.id는 잘 나오는데 editingId의 경우 처음 null 이 오고 계속 전값들이 찍혀서요(계속 클릭한 전 x값들이 editingID에 찍힘). setEditingId 함수로 editingID 값 변경까지 시간 딜레이가 있어서 일까요? 작동은 잘 합니다만, 공부하느라 console.log를 찍어보다 의문점이 들어서요!
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 기본 강의
react-router-dom v6 써서 component 에 hoc 적용하는법 찾으시는 분들
App.js 에서 react-router-dom v6 버전에 맞게 문법을 Switch 대신 Routes 로 바꾸는 부분과 component 대신 element 로 바꾸시고 꼼수(?)로 Auth로 감싼 컴포넌트를 새로 정의해서 넣으시면 작동은 됩니다..